Large older black lab found in median of hwy 80 by windmill farms. If you are his owner or know who he belongs to, he has been taken to Forney Animal Hospital to be taken care of. He has been hurt and looks like he is in extreme pain.

The owner of this dog was found. The dog - Tag - was pretty banged up but doing better. Unfortunately there were 2 dogs ~ the other one did not make it. Apparently someone stole both of them or let them out. They were hit on highway 80. There has been a rash of dogs disappearing from their backyards in WMF. Another reason to keep locks on your gates.
